Wellness Risks of Mycotoxins





Exposure to mycotoxins positions significant wellness risks to both animals and human beings, requiring watchful surveillance and control measures. In people, mycotoxins such as ochratoxins, fumonisins, and aflatoxins can cause a range of negative results, including liver damage, kidney poisoning, immune reductions, and also carcinogenic effects.

In pets, intake of mycotoxin-contaminated feed can lead to minimized development rates, reproductive concerns, and increased vulnerability to diseases as a result of immune reductions. Persistent exposure can bring about organ damages, minimized productivity, and in extreme cases, fatality. The financial implications are additionally substantial, influencing livestock wellness and efficiency, which can translate right into significant monetary losses for farmers and the agricultural market.


Given these extreme health repercussions, it is vital to apply robust mycotoxin screening procedures. Accurate detection and metrology of mycotoxins in food and feed are necessary to minimize health threats and make sure public and animal security.




Usual Sources of Contamination

Infected agricultural products are a main source of mycotoxins, with cereals, nuts, and dried fruits being particularly vulnerable. Mycotoxins, hazardous additional metabolites produced by fungi, grow in certain environmental problems such as high humidity and temperature levels. Consequently, plants like maize, rice, barley, and wheat are often affected, positioning significant threats to both human and animal health.


In addition to grains, nuts such as peanuts, almonds, and pistachios are extremely vulnerable to mycotoxin contamination. Aflatoxins, a potent type of mycotoxin, are frequently found in these nuts, specifically when storage space conditions are suboptimal. Dried out fruits, including raisins, apricots, and figs, additionally present abundant grounds for fungal growth as a result of their high sugar content and moisture-retaining properties.


Moreover, contamination is not restricted to raw agricultural products. Refined foods, pet feeds, and milk products can likewise have mycotoxins if the initial components were infected. This extends the threat of exposure throughout the food supply chain, requiring rigorous monitoring and control steps.


Comprehending the usual resources of mycotoxin contamination is important for applying effective preventative techniques. Alleviating these dangers at the resource can significantly decrease the occurrence of mycotoxin-related health problems, protecting public health and wellness.


Checking Approaches and Methods



Advanced analytical strategies are utilized to discover and quantify mycotoxins in various substratums, making sure public health and wellness safety. High-Performance Liquid Chromatography (HPLC) combined with mass spectrometry (MS) is a gold standard in mycotoxin screening, supplying high level of sensitivity and specificity.


An additional extensively used approach is Enzyme-Linked Immunosorbent Assay (ELISA), which uses rapid testing and is economical for big example quantities - Mycotoxin testing Services. ELISA packages are useful because of their ease of usage and quick turnaround time, making them appropriate for on-site testing


Testing protocols are just as important. Proper tasting guarantees that the accumulated specimens are depictive of the entire set, thus minimizing the threat of false downsides or positives. Adherence to established guidelines, such read review as those given by the International Company for Standardization (ISO) and the European Board for Standardization (CEN), is important for keeping consistency and integrity across screening methods.




Extensive recognition of these procedures and approaches is indispensable. It makes certain reproducibility and precision, thereby fortifying the stability of mycotoxin monitoring systems.
